Discovering the Triumph of Lantern Pharma in Precision Oncology with AI Technology

Lantern Pharma is a biotechnology company that is revolutionizing the field of precision oncology with the use of artificial intelligence (AI) technology. The company’s mission is to develop personalized cancer treatments that are tailored to the unique genetic makeup of each patient. By using AI to analyze vast amounts of genomic data, Lantern Pharma is able to identify specific genetic mutations that drive cancer growth and develop targeted therapies to combat them.

Precision oncology is a relatively new field that has emerged in recent years as a result of advances in genomic sequencing technology. The goal of precision oncology is to develop treatments that are tailored to the specific genetic mutations that drive cancer growth in individual patients. This approach is in contrast to traditional cancer treatments, which are often based on the location of the tumor rather than the underlying genetic mutations.

Lantern Pharma’s approach to precision oncology involves using AI to analyze large datasets of genomic data from cancer patients. The company’s proprietary AI platform, RADR, is able to identify specific genetic mutations that are associated with cancer growth and predict which drugs are most likely to be effective in targeting those mutations. This approach allows Lantern Pharma to develop personalized cancer treatments that are tailored to the unique genetic makeup of each patient.

One of the key advantages of Lantern Pharma’s approach is that it allows for faster and more efficient drug development. Traditional drug development can take years and cost billions of dollars, but Lantern Pharma’s AI platform allows the company to identify promising drug candidates much more quickly and at a lower cost. This means that new treatments can be developed and brought to market more quickly, potentially saving lives and improving outcomes for cancer patients.

Lantern Pharma has already made significant progress in the field of precision oncology. The company has several drug candidates in development, including LP-184, which is being developed for the treatment of non-small cell lung cancer. LP-184 targets a specific genetic mutation that is found in approximately 20% of non-small cell lung cancer patients, and early clinical trials have shown promising results.

In addition to its drug development efforts, Lantern Pharma is also working to build partnerships with other companies and organizations in the field of precision oncology. The company recently announced a collaboration with the National Cancer Institute (NCI) to develop new cancer treatments using AI technology. This partnership will allow Lantern Pharma to access the NCI’s vast database of genomic data and accelerate its drug development efforts.

Overall, Lantern Pharma is a company that is at the forefront of the precision oncology revolution. By using AI technology to develop personalized cancer treatments, the company is helping to improve outcomes for cancer patients and bring new treatments to market more quickly. As the field of precision oncology continues to evolve, it is likely that Lantern Pharma will continue to play a leading role in this important area of research.
